Details:
On April 12, 2022, at 7:00 A.M., deputies assigned to the Coachella Community Action Team (CCAT), with the assistance of the Southern Coachella Valley Community Service District Team (SCVCSDT), served a search warrant at a residence located in the 43-500 block of Pueblo Street in the city of Indio. The search warrant stemmed from a burglary incident which occurred in the city of Coachella.
During the search warrant, a handgun, which was loaded with an extended magazine, was located and seized. Documented gang member Leonardo Gallardo, 20 of Indio, was arrested for numerous firearm violations. Gallardo was booked at the John Benoit Detention Center in the city of Indio.
